jQuery技术详解及其SEO优化优势
引言
jQuery是一个快速、小巧且功能丰富的JavaScript库,广泛用于简化HTML文档遍历、事件处理、动画和Ajax交互。本文将深入探讨jQuery的基本用法和优势,并讨论它对SEO的影响。
基本用法
jQuery通过其简洁的语法和丰富的插件系统,使得前端开发变得更加高效。以下是一些基本示例:
- 选择元素:$(‘div’) – 选择所有
<div>
元素。 - 事件处理:$(‘#button’).click(function() { … }); – 为按钮添加点击事件。
- 动画:$(‘.box’).slideUp(); – 隐藏一个元素并带有滑动动画效果。
jQuery的优势
jQuery因其跨浏览器兼容性、简洁的语法和丰富的插件生态系统而备受欢迎:
- 跨浏览器兼容性:jQuery处理了浏览器间的差异,使开发者无需编写额外的代码。
- 简洁的语法:jQuery的语法比纯JavaScript更简洁,易于学习和使用。
- 丰富的插件:庞大的jQuery插件库使得扩展功能变得简单。
jQuery对SEO的影响
虽然jQuery本身不会对SEO产生直接影响,但使用jQuery时需要注意以下几个方面以确保SEO友好:
- 确保内容可抓取:不要使用jQuery动态生成主要内容,因为搜索引擎爬虫可能无法抓取这些内容。
- 使用渐进增强:确保网页在不启用JavaScript的情况下也能工作,以提供基本功能和内容。
- Ajax内容优化:通过服务器端的渲染或使用Google的Ajax Crawling Scheme,确保Ajax内容能被搜索引擎索引。
结论
jQuery是一个强大且灵活的JavaScript库,极大地简化了前端开发。通过合理地使用jQuery并注意SEO最佳实践,开发者可以创建既美观又易于搜索引擎索引的网页。
// 示例jQuery脚本,用于页面加载后的操作
$(document).ready(function() {
console.log(‘jQuery已加载并准备就绪’);
// 例如,添加一个点击事件到所有按钮上
$(‘button’).click(function() {
alert(‘按钮被点击了!’);
});
});